Output 639d34d24fabe9cd5594392dc6eaa3351b5379dbc0f60702849dccea5d952e5a:0

value
2978062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1da378478747413b5b26a31556a48ed881e7f1c1 OP_EQUAL
address
34PjMC1EDxSAnSFH9bXAGwiToGzCcFoRz7
transaction
639d34d24fabe9cd5594392dc6eaa3351b5379dbc0f60702849dccea5d952e5a